At TU Delft a number of scholarships are available for excellent international applicants. Justus & Louise Van Effen Excellence Scholarships are financed by the legacy of Justus and Louise van Effen. Mr. van Effen studied at TU Delft in the 1940’s and strongly believed technological developments will contribute to solving societal issues.
The Foundation Justus & Louise van Effen was established with the aim of stimulating excellent international MSc students and financially supporting them in their wish to study at TU Delft.
Host Institution(s):TU Delft, The Netherlands
Level/Field(s) of study:2-year Regular TU Delft’s MSc programmes
Number of Scholarships in the Justus & Louise van Effen excellence Scholarships:2 per faculty
Target group:International students
Scholarship value/inclusions/duration:The Justus & Louise van Effen excellence Scholarship include full tuition fees per year for a TU Delft MSc programme based on the statutory fee or institutional rate, according to the registered nationality, and contribution for living expenses
Eligibility for the Excellence Scholarships
You must be an excellent international applicant (conditionally) admitted to one of the 2-year Regular TU Delft’s MSc programmes, with a cumulative grade point average (GPA) of 80 percent or higher of the scale maximum in your bachelor’s degree from an internationally renowned university outside The Netherlands.
